WebSyntax. matplotlib.pyplot.hist (x, bins, range, density, weights, cumulative, bottom, histtype, align, orientation, rwidth, log, color, label, stacked) The x argument is the only required parameter. It represents the values that will be plotted and can be of type float or array. Other parameters are optional and can be used to customize plot ... Web(or you may alternatively use bar()).. cumulative bool or -1, default: False. If True, then a histogram is computed where each bin gives the counts in that bin plus all bins for smaller values.The last bin gives the total number of datapoints. If density is also True then the histogram is normalized such that the last bin equals 1.. If cumulative is a number less …

WebJun 22, 2024 · Define Matplotlib Histogram Bin Size. You can define the bins by using the bins= argument. This accepts either a number (for number of bins) or a list (for specific bins). If bins is an int, it defines the number of equal-width bins in the given range (10, by default). If bins is a sequence, it defines a monotonically increasing array of bin edges, including the rightmost edge, allowing for non-uniform bin widths.
